From Reynisfjara earth, so called green energy, for heating their homes. Tonight we will take a northern lights tour. We drive in the twilight chasing the Aurora Borealis. This is a mystery- filled tour. The destination is not decided in advance, since we will try to find the best place away from the city lights.
